IST to AWST Time Converter

Use this IST to AWST time converter to compare India and Australia time instantly. AWST is 2 hours and 30 minutes ahead of IST, so 9:00 AM IST becomes 11:30 AM AWST and 5:00 PM IST becomes 7:30 PM AWST.
